- Dubbo 支持哪些协议,每种协议的应用场景,优缺点? dubbo: 单一长连接和 NIO 异步通讯,适合大并发小数据量的服务调用, 以及消费者远大于提供者。传输协议 TCP,异步,Hessian 序列化; rmi: 采用 JDK 标准的 rmi 协议实现,传输参数和返回参数对象需要实现 Serializable 接口,使用 java 标准序列化机制,使用阻... Dubbo 支持哪些协议,每种协议的应用场景,优缺点? dubbo: 单一长连接和 NIO 异步通讯,适合大并发小数据量的服务调用, 以及消费者远大于提供者。传输协议 TCP,异步,Hessian 序列化; rmi: 采用 JDK 标准的 rmi 协议实现,传输参数和返回参数对象需要实现 Serializable 接口,使用 java 标准序列化机制,使用阻...
- 讲解前,先说一下整个系统框架的基本构造: zookeeper作为注册中心,使用单独服务器,占用2181端口;dubbo-admin作为监控中心,与zookeeper使用相同服务器,tomcat部署占用8080端口;provider作为服务提供者,使用单独服务器,tomcat部署占用8080端口,使用dubbo协议开放20880端口;consumer作为服务消费者,使用... 讲解前,先说一下整个系统框架的基本构造: zookeeper作为注册中心,使用单独服务器,占用2181端口;dubbo-admin作为监控中心,与zookeeper使用相同服务器,tomcat部署占用8080端口;provider作为服务提供者,使用单独服务器,tomcat部署占用8080端口,使用dubbo协议开放20880端口;consumer作为服务消费者,使用...
- 讲解前,先说一下整个系统框架的基本构造: zookeeper作为注册中心,使用单独服务器,占用2181端口;dubbo-admin作为监控中心,与zookeeper使用相同服务器,tomcat部署占用8080端口;provider作为服务提供者,使用单独服务器,tomcat部署占用8080端口,使用dubbo协议开放20880端口;consumer作为服务消费者,使用... 讲解前,先说一下整个系统框架的基本构造: zookeeper作为注册中心,使用单独服务器,占用2181端口;dubbo-admin作为监控中心,与zookeeper使用相同服务器,tomcat部署占用8080端口;provider作为服务提供者,使用单独服务器,tomcat部署占用8080端口,使用dubbo协议开放20880端口;consumer作为服务消费者,使用...
- #Dubbo进阶(九)—— dubbo monitor chart无图解决方案 是否为启动了dubbo monitor而没有图表显示而苦恼?是否为有了图表但是却发现统计不了数据而烦躁。到底是谁在作祟呢?下面我们就来看看。 当图表无法显示时,你要看看你的配置文件项dubbo.jetty.directory这个文件夹到底存不存在,因为默认不会自动给你创建的。这个选项... #Dubbo进阶(九)—— dubbo monitor chart无图解决方案 是否为启动了dubbo monitor而没有图表显示而苦恼?是否为有了图表但是却发现统计不了数据而烦躁。到底是谁在作祟呢?下面我们就来看看。 当图表无法显示时,你要看看你的配置文件项dubbo.jetty.directory这个文件夹到底存不存在,因为默认不会自动给你创建的。这个选项...
- 当一个接口有多种实现时,可以应用group区分。 为什么要用dubbo分组配置? 因为服务器有限,想在同一个注册中心中,分隔测试和开发环境。 那么,分组如何配置? spring管理bean,先看dubbo的配置: 1、service中的dubbo配置: spring-dubbo.xml: <?xml version="1.0" encoding="UT... 当一个接口有多种实现时,可以应用group区分。 为什么要用dubbo分组配置? 因为服务器有限,想在同一个注册中心中,分隔测试和开发环境。 那么,分组如何配置? spring管理bean,先看dubbo的配置: 1、service中的dubbo配置: spring-dubbo.xml: <?xml version="1.0" encoding="UT...
- #Dubbo进阶(二) —— 搭建Dubbo开发环境 本文是基于maven的,在开发Dubbo应用之前,先安装maven。 dubbo是一个分布式服务框架,提供一个SOA的解决方案。简单的说,dubbo就像在生产者和消费者中间架起了一座桥梁,使之能透明交互。 本文旨在搭建一个可供使用和测试的dubbo环境,使用了spring框架;使用了zooke... #Dubbo进阶(二) —— 搭建Dubbo开发环境 本文是基于maven的,在开发Dubbo应用之前,先安装maven。 dubbo是一个分布式服务框架,提供一个SOA的解决方案。简单的说,dubbo就像在生产者和消费者中间架起了一座桥梁,使之能透明交互。 本文旨在搭建一个可供使用和测试的dubbo环境,使用了spring框架;使用了zooke...
- #dubbo-monitor-simple使用 ##使用步骤 1、下载dubbo-monitor-simple-2.8.4-assembly.tar.gz(点击下载)。2、上传dubbo-monitor-simple-2.8.4-assembly.tar.gz到服务器,解压之。3、修改dubbo.properties dubbo.container=log4j,sp... #dubbo-monitor-simple使用 ##使用步骤 1、下载dubbo-monitor-simple-2.8.4-assembly.tar.gz(点击下载)。2、上传dubbo-monitor-simple-2.8.4-assembly.tar.gz到服务器,解压之。3、修改dubbo.properties dubbo.container=log4j,sp...
- #Dubbo进阶(六)—— Zookeeper注册中心和Dubbo-Admin管理平台的搭建 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、名字服务、分布式同步、组服务等。 ZooKe... #Dubbo进阶(六)—— Zookeeper注册中心和Dubbo-Admin管理平台的搭建 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。它是一个为分布式应用提供一致性服务的软件,提供的功能包括:配置维护、名字服务、分布式同步、组服务等。 ZooKe...
- Dubbo进阶(十)—— dubbo2.8.4的各种坑记录 从dubbo2.5.3升级到2.8.4,出现各种问题,在此记录一下,仅供参考。 1. dubbo支持jdk 1.8及以上,注意jdk版本; 2. 调用rest报错 严重: Error javascript:;" class="gotosearch" style="color: #002be... Dubbo进阶(十)—— dubbo2.8.4的各种坑记录 从dubbo2.5.3升级到2.8.4,出现各种问题,在此记录一下,仅供参考。 1. dubbo支持jdk 1.8及以上,注意jdk版本; 2. 调用rest报错 严重: Error javascript:;" class="gotosearch" style="color: #002be...
- #Dubbo进阶(四)—— dubbo-monitor安装、 监控中心 配置过程 使用dubbo的话,两个工具是不可少的: dubbo的管理控制台dubbo-admin,在之前的博文《Dubbo进阶(六)—— Zookeeper注册中心和Dubbo-Admin管理平台的搭建》中介绍过;简易控制中心monitor; ##monitor简单介绍 首先需要... #Dubbo进阶(四)—— dubbo-monitor安装、 监控中心 配置过程 使用dubbo的话,两个工具是不可少的: dubbo的管理控制台dubbo-admin,在之前的博文《Dubbo进阶(六)—— Zookeeper注册中心和Dubbo-Admin管理平台的搭建》中介绍过;简易控制中心monitor; ##monitor简单介绍 首先需要...
- Dubbo服务治理 在大规模服务化之前,应用可能只是通过RMI或Hessian等工具,简单的暴露和引用远程服务,通过配置服务的URL地址进行调用,通过F5等硬件进行负载均衡。 (1) 当服务越来越多时,服务URL配置管理变得非常困难,F5硬件负载均衡器的单点压力也越来越大。 此时需要一个服务注册中心,动态的注册和发现服务,使服务的位置透明。 并通过在消费方获取服务提供方... Dubbo服务治理 在大规模服务化之前,应用可能只是通过RMI或Hessian等工具,简单的暴露和引用远程服务,通过配置服务的URL地址进行调用,通过F5等硬件进行负载均衡。 (1) 当服务越来越多时,服务URL配置管理变得非常困难,F5硬件负载均衡器的单点压力也越来越大。 此时需要一个服务注册中心,动态的注册和发现服务,使服务的位置透明。 并通过在消费方获取服务提供方...
- #Dubbo进阶(八)—— no provider available for the service错误解决方案 在分布式项目中Dubbo发布服务报No provider available for the service错误。错误信息如下: Caused by: org.springframework.beans.factory.BeanCreationE... #Dubbo进阶(八)—— no provider available for the service错误解决方案 在分布式项目中Dubbo发布服务报No provider available for the service错误。错误信息如下: Caused by: org.springframework.beans.factory.BeanCreationE...
- 文章目录 一、分布式基本理论 1.1、分布式基本定义 1.2 架构发展演变 1.3、RPC简介 二、Dubbo理论简介 三、Dubbo环境搭建 3.1 Zookeeper搭建 3.2 Dubbo管理页面搭建 四、Dubbo服务注册发现例子 4.1、业务场景 4.2、api工程创建 4.3、服务提供者工程 4.4、服务消费者工程... 文章目录 一、分布式基本理论 1.1、分布式基本定义 1.2 架构发展演变 1.3、RPC简介 二、Dubbo理论简介 三、Dubbo环境搭建 3.1 Zookeeper搭建 3.2 Dubbo管理页面搭建 四、Dubbo服务注册发现例子 4.1、业务场景 4.2、api工程创建 4.3、服务提供者工程 4.4、服务消费者工程...
- 文章目录 一、分布式基本理论1.1、分布式基本定义1.2 架构发展演变1.3、RPC简介 二、Dubbo理论简介三、Dubbo环境搭建3.1 Zookeeper搭建3.2 Dubbo管理页面搭建 四、Dubbo服务注册发现例子4.1、业务场景4.2、api工程创建4.3、服务提供者工程4.4、服务消费者工程 一、分布式基本理论 1.1、分布式基... 文章目录 一、分布式基本理论1.1、分布式基本定义1.2 架构发展演变1.3、RPC简介 二、Dubbo理论简介三、Dubbo环境搭建3.1 Zookeeper搭建3.2 Dubbo管理页面搭建 四、Dubbo服务注册发现例子4.1、业务场景4.2、api工程创建4.3、服务提供者工程4.4、服务消费者工程 一、分布式基本理论 1.1、分布式基...
- SpringBoot系列之集成Dubbo的方式 本博客介绍Springboot框架集成Dubbo实现微服务的3种常用方式,对于Dubbo知识不是很熟悉的,请先学习我上一篇博客:SpringBoot系列之集成Dubbo实现微服务教程,本博客只是对上篇博客的补充,上篇博客已经介绍过的就不重复介绍 还是使用上篇博客的例子,业务场景: 某个电商系统,订单服务需要调用用户服... SpringBoot系列之集成Dubbo的方式 本博客介绍Springboot框架集成Dubbo实现微服务的3种常用方式,对于Dubbo知识不是很熟悉的,请先学习我上一篇博客:SpringBoot系列之集成Dubbo实现微服务教程,本博客只是对上篇博客的补充,上篇博客已经介绍过的就不重复介绍 还是使用上篇博客的例子,业务场景: 某个电商系统,订单服务需要调用用户服...
上滑加载中
推荐直播
-
HDC深度解读系列 - Serverless与MCP融合创新,构建AI应用全新智能中枢2025/08/20 周三 16:30-18:00
张昆鹏 HCDG北京核心组代表
HDC2025期间,华为云展示了Serverless与MCP融合创新的解决方案,本期访谈直播,由华为云开发者专家(HCDE)兼华为云开发者社区组织HCDG北京核心组代表张鹏先生主持,华为云PaaS服务产品部 Serverless总监Ewen为大家深度解读华为云Serverless与MCP如何融合构建AI应用全新智能中枢
回顾中 -
关于RISC-V生态发展的思考2025/09/02 周二 17:00-18:00
中国科学院计算技术研究所副所长包云岗教授
中科院包云岗老师将在本次直播中,探讨处理器生态的关键要素及其联系,分享过去几年推动RISC-V生态建设实践过程中的经验与教训。
回顾中 -
一键搞定华为云万级资源,3步轻松管理企业成本2025/09/09 周二 15:00-16:00
阿言 华为云交易产品经理
本直播重点介绍如何一键续费万级资源,3步轻松管理成本,帮助提升日常管理效率!
回顾中
热门标签